Summer Camp Counselor

The Brookline Recreation department is seeking qualified, energetic, and compassionate candidates for the 2026 summer camp season. Previous experience with camp programming or previous counselor experience is preferred. Hourly rates are based on camp position. The Summer Camp program will run from July 6, 2026 to August 14, 2026 at three elementary schools in Brookline, MA.

Staff is required to attend 3 days of mandatory training during the week of June 30 - July 2 with specific schedules to be determined. Below is a brief description of the open positions. All candidates will go through a background check through the Criminal and Sexual Offender database as required by the Town of Brookline health department.

Counselor

  • Schedule: July 6, 2026 to August 14, 2026; M-F: 8:15am to 4:00pm
  • Pay Rate: $17.50 per hour
  • Requirements: Must be minimum 17 years old
  • General Responsibilities: Be responsible for the welfare of each individual in the program and do all possible to resolve problems. Assist those campers who may have difficulty fitting into the camp environment. Will take part in swim lessons with campers.
  • Reports To: Head Counselor, Camp Director
